Chartio is a business intelligence system that makes databases as easy to analyze as a spreadsheet. You don’t need to know SQL or a proprietary language to use Chartio, but you can use SQL if you prefer. Chartio enables business users to transform data themselves – without the help of a data scientist. Chartio is simple to set up. You can connect and start analyzing your data in less than an hour. And it gives you the flexibility to quickly add new data and storage as your needs change.

25 Best Reporting Tools for 2022
It features data exploration, customizable dashboards, and different types of charts. Chartio provides users connections from Amazon Redshift to CSV files helping them explore data. Users can also share dashboards and reports with members via E-Mail and track corporate metrics using the solution’s Snapshot feature.

    The only thing you can do is ignore them, anything else is kicking the can down the road as you cannot meet their demands forever. You should run a virus scan on every device you use and implement unique passwords for each account + two factor authentication everywhere. Once you've done that, review your accounts for any unauthorized changes, paying special attention to all security settings. If you're worried... Source: about 3 years ago
